There are older pets that are fully trained and used to living with cats, dogs and people (including kids!). Some older pets have often had a rough go of it and spent time on the streets. Others are scared and confused in the shelter after years doing their best in what they thought was their permanent home.

However they got to ACCT and from wherever they came, older pets are not suited for shelter life. They deserve some comfort and love in their prime and into their golden years. The older pets at ACCT now are a healthy bunch and have plenty of life, love and loads of fun to offer the right home. Older pets are great for a chaotic household as they need less training and supervision. They are also perfect first time pets as they fit right into any lifestyle and are super low maintenance but great and willing companions.
